Sidsel Endresen is a beloved vocalist, improviser, explorer and teacher. She has been called Norway's queen vocalist many times, guided by her curiosity she has kept exploring throughout her whole carreer.
She experienced a big commercial success as a jazzpop-vocalist in Jon Eberson Group early in her carreer, but she's maybe more known for her innovation in vocal improvisation and contemporary free improvisation. She is internationally recognized as a pioneer in exploration of the voice and improvisation with text fragments and dadaist phrases.
